The family is guided, coached & taught how to interact with the child through all their working hours. Counselling of parents at regular intervals is an important part of the Centre’s work in order to guide them on all aspects of the child’s overall development.

Education for the children is free. However AVT is charged for at a highly subsidised rate of `500 a month. There are a number of children who find it difficult to pay this amount too.

The strategies used in teaching to learn to listen language relies heavily on emulating real life in the class room. Also toys and books play a crucial role in engaging a young child and helping it develop skills like motor control, reading, in addition to developing cognition. Hence toys and books are important to our program.

Cochlear implants are prohibitively expensive, quite beyond the reach of even mid-income families. However their benefits offset this expense. They prove to be a boon for the hearing impaired child and help it to learn to listen, aquire language and learn to speak.

This intervention greatly influences the habilitation of the hearing impaired child in the normally listening world , giving them opportunities for success in most aspects of life.

The total cost of surgery and the device along with associated diagnostics costs upwards of `6 lakhs.

Surgery costs are between `1,00,000 to `1,50,000. MRIs, CT scans & other blood tests are required before a surgery for Cochlear Implants is carried out.

Our children wear cochlear implants in one ear. In the non implanted ear they must wear a suitable hearing aid. Both these devices need to be regularly checked on as well as maintained. Mapping of the implant is carried out every three months by default.

Audiograms are then conduted to test the efficiancy of the implant and the hearing aid.
However the tests are carried out as and when indicated by necessity.

Other than routine running expenses EAR spends nearly Rs.15000 a month towards music classes, Rs.20000 a month towards dance classes and Rs.18000 per month towards giving children a better nutrition.

Occupational and speech therapy costs another 20000 per month for the needy children.
